The difference between topsoil and garden soil is often a source of confusion for consumers starting a new landscaping or gardening project. Both products are sold in bags and bulk, leading many to believe the terms are interchangeable. Understanding the distinction between these two materials—which lies in their composition, sourcing, and intended purpose—is the first step toward a successful outdoor endeavor. Topsoil: Understanding the Base Layer
Topsoil is the uppermost, naturally occurring layer of the earth, typically extending 5 to 10 inches deep. This layer contains the highest concentration of organic matter and microorganisms. Commercial topsoil is sourced primarily by stripping this layer from construction sites or land development projects before the area is disturbed.
Topsoil structure is determined by a blend of mineral particles: sand, silt, and clay. The ratio of these components dictates the soil’s texture, which varies significantly based on geographic location. Consequently, the quality and consistency of standard topsoil can be highly variable, sometimes containing rocks, unrefined organic solids, or weed seeds.
The primary function of topsoil is structural, serving as a base layer rather than an optimized growing medium. It is used to fill low spots, level uneven ground, or build up soil volume in a large area. While it contains some natural nutrients, these levels are often inconsistent and insufficient to support demanding plant growth without further amendment.
Garden Soil: The Customized Growing Medium
In contrast to the natural origin of topsoil, garden soil is a manufactured product engineered for plant performance. It starts with a base of screened topsoil or similar mineral components, which is then blended with organic materials. This blending process aims to create an ideal loamy texture that promotes both drainage and moisture retention.
The added organic matter, which may include compost, aged manure, or peat moss, maximizes the soil’s nutrient profile. These amendments ensure a steady supply of nitrogen, phosphorus, and potassium, readily available for plant uptake. Garden soils also often contain specialized ingredients like perlite or vermiculite, which enhance aeration and prevent compaction around developing root systems.
This customized mixture provides optimal conditions for vigorous growth, balancing the needs for water, air, and nutrition. Garden soil typically has a more uniform particle size and a lighter, more workable texture than unamended topsoil. Its composition makes it suitable for high-yield applications, such as growing vegetables, flowers, or herbs.
Choosing the Right Soil for Your Project
The decision between topsoil and garden soil should be based on the project’s scale and its specific needs for volume and nutrition. Topsoil is the appropriate choice for large-scale landscaping tasks where the main requirement is bulk volume and filling capacity. Using it to establish a new lawn or to repair a large, sunken area is cost-effective because it is generally much cheaper per cubic yard than garden soil.
If the goal is to grow plants in a confined space, garden soil is the superior choice for its tailored composition. Raised garden beds, vegetable patches, and flower borders benefit immensely from the enriched, balanced blend of garden soil. Although it comes at a higher cost, its specialized nutrient content eliminates the immediate need for extensive amendments or fertilizers.
Layering for Raised Beds
For projects like filling a deep raised bed, a practical approach is to layer the materials to manage both budget and performance. A cheaper, high-quality topsoil can be used to fill the bottom two-thirds of the bed, providing necessary structure and volume. The upper layer, where most plant roots will actively feed, should then be filled with the nutrient-dense garden soil.
It is important to remember that the quality of both products varies widely depending on the supplier. Consumers should inspect the product for a rich, dark color and a crumbly texture. Matching the soil’s purpose—structural base versus customized growing medium—is the most reliable way to ensure a successful outcome for any outdoor project.
